Synthetic Ultralightweight Mid Sock

Description

Built to hug the foot, our lightest sock minimizes cushioning and aligns with the fit of our shoes to create a system that helps mitigate friction on long mountain runs and hikes. Made with wicking fibres, the performance polyester yarns help manage temperature and moisture. The minimalist design eliminates the toe seam, has a gridded construction at the arch for support and airflow, and a collar height that helps seal out trail debris.

Features & Specs

Technical features

  • Moisture-wicking
  • Breathable
  • Lightweight

Construction

  • Made from durable, comfortable 37.5® performance polyester yarns specifically engineered for temperature regulation and climate control
  • Low-profile grid construction at the arch for breathable comfort and added support
  • Seamless toe minimizes potential irritation
  • Mid-height helps prevent slipping and seals out trail debris

Layering

Layers are the instruments of keeping you dry, warm and using your energy efficiently. Put into the right systems, a good sequence of layers provides you with weather protection, moves moisture away from your skin, conserves or dissipates heat, and does this in the least amount of time.
